来源:小编 更新:2024-12-03 07:51:48
用手机看
Scratch,一款由麻省理工学院(MIT)开发的教育软件,旨在帮助孩子们通过可视化编程的方式学习编程。它以其直观的图形界面和丰富的模块库,让编程变得简单有趣。今天,我们就来一起探索如何使用Scratch制作一款属于自己的游戏。
Scratch是一款面向6-16岁儿童的编程工具,它允许用户通过拖拽和组合各种编程模块来创建游戏、动画和故事。Scratch的设计理念是鼓励创新和创造性思维,通过游戏化的学习方式,让孩子们在玩乐中学习编程。
在开始制作游戏之前,我们需要做一些准备工作:
安装Scratch软件:从Scratch官方网站下载并安装最新版本的Scratch软件。
构思游戏创意:确定游戏的主题、玩法和目标。
收集素材:准备游戏所需的图片、音乐和声音等素材。
游戏界面是玩家与游戏互动的第一步,因此设计一个吸引人的界面非常重要。
创建舞台:在Scratch中,舞台是游戏的背景。你可以使用内置的背景,也可以导入自己的图片作为背景。
添加角色:根据游戏需要,添加不同的角色。在Scratch中,角色被称为“精灵”。你可以导入自己的图片,或者使用Scratch内置的角色。
设置角色造型:为每个角色设计不同的造型,以适应不同的游戏场景。
游戏逻辑是游戏的核心,决定了游戏的玩法和规则。
设置角色行为:使用Scratch的编程模块,为角色设置移动、跳跃、攻击等行为。
编写事件响应:当玩家进行操作时,如点击、按键等,游戏需要做出相应的反应。在Scratch中,这被称为“事件”。
添加得分和生命值:根据游戏规则,设置得分和生命值,并在界面上显示。
游戏制作完成后,需要进行测试以确保游戏运行顺畅,没有bug。
运行游戏:在Scratch中运行游戏,检查游戏是否按照预期运行。
收集反馈:邀请朋友或家人试玩游戏,收集他们的反馈意见。
优化游戏:根据反馈意见,对游戏进行优化,如调整难度、改进界面等。
完成游戏后,你可以将游戏分享给其他人,或者将其作为模板进行再创作。
导出游戏:在Scratch中,你可以将游戏导出为视频、图片或可执行文件。
上传分享:将游戏上传到Scratch社区或其他平台,与其他人分享你的作品。
再创作:从其他优秀作品中学习,不断改进自己的游戏。
使用Scratch制作游戏是一个充满乐趣和挑战的过程。通过学习Scratch,孩子们不仅能够掌握编程技能,还能培养创新思维和解决问题的能力。让我们一起动手,用Scratch打造属于你的专属游戏吧!